Created by the pioneering foundry , Yoon Gothic was revolutionary when it was released in 1999. It broke from the traditional, rigid square grid of many Korean fonts, introducing a sleek, modern sans-serif aesthetic that prioritized legibility and a clean, contemporary feel. The font's refined structure and balanced letterforms make it highly readable both in print and on screens, a quality that has cemented its place as a classic.
